Following the success of the first volume of The Little Things, not surprisingly comes More Little Things Written by Matt Lawrey and drawn by Peter Lole, The Little Things is the most successful cartoon to come out of New Zealand in many years, and this book is a second collection from the popular daily newspaper feature of the same name. Now published in newspapers across New Zealand and Australia, the cartoons are clever, poignant and sometimes downright hilarious. More Little Things will make you laugh, make you think, and best of all remind you that no parent has it easy. Parenting is one of life's most universal experiences, and there is a huge appetite for these beautifully realised cartoons, making this book the ideal gift for the mums and dads in your life.

MATT LAWREY is an award-winning radio host, a weekly newspaper columnist, and a film reviewer on a community newspaper. He has also worked on television as a presenter of New Zealand’s national lottery, Lotto. He lives in Nelson with his wife and two children.


PETER LOLE is originally from the UK. After studying at the Coventry College of Art he has worked as an illustrator for over 30 years in the UK, Canada and New Zealand. He has three children, and lives with his wife in Nelson.
